How much do quality supervisor j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 17, 2026, the average yearly pay for quality supervisor in Appleton, WI is $88,837.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$68,800.00 and $107,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a quality supervisor?

Quality Supervisors are professionals responsible for overseeing and maintaining the quality standards within a manufacturing or production environment. They monitor production processes, inspect products, and ensure compliance with company and industry regulations. Their role often includes training staff on quality procedures, identifying areas for improvement, and addressing any issues that arise to prevent defects. By doing so, Quality Supervisors help ensure that products meet customer expectations and safety requirements.

How does a quality supervisor typically collaborate with production and engineering teams to address quality issues?

A Quality Supervisor plays a crucial role in bridging the gap between quality assurance, production, and engineering teams. They regularly participate in cross-functional meetings to review quality metrics, discuss recurring issues, and develop corrective action plans. This collaboration ensures that quality standards are consistently met and that any defects are quickly identified and resolved. By fostering open communication and providing training on quality protocols, Quality Supervisors help drive continuous improvement and maintain compliance with industry regulations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a quality supervisor,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Quality Supervisor, you need a solid understanding of quality assurance processes, auditing techniques, regulatory standards, and typically a degree in engineering or a related technical field. Familiarity with quality management systems such as ISO 9001, Six Sigma methodologies, and data analysis tools is often required, along with relevant certifications like CQE or Six Sigma Green Belt. Strong leadership, attention to detail, problem-solving ability, and effective communication are valuable soft skills in this role. These competencies ensure consistent product quality, regulatory compliance, and continuous improvement in manufacturing or service environments.
